Former Men's Tennis Standout Barth Joins ITA HOF

May 20, 2019 | Men's Tennis

ORLANDO, Fla. โ€“ Former UCLA standout Roy Barth was inducted into the Intercollegiate Tennis Association (ITA) Men's Collegiate Tennis Hall of Fame Sunday, becoming the 22nd Bruin to join the prestigious club.

The governing body of college tennis welcomed six new members as part of the annual ITA Men's Collegiate Tennis Hall of Fame Induction Luncheon, held prior to the start of the NCAA Division I men's team championship match at the USTA National Campus. Joining Barth in the class were coaches Dave Fish and Greg Patton and players Somdev Devvarman, Sargis Sargsian and Doug Verdieck.

Part of head coach Glenn Bassett's first three teams (1967-69), Barth co-captained the Bruins with Steve Tidball in 1969. Barth and Tidball achieved All-America status as doubles partners in 1968 and 1969, posting a top-three showing each year. In 1968, Barth-Tidball finished as the national runner-up to Bob Lutz and Stan Smith of USC. UCLA went a combined 44-5-1 in Barth's three seasons in Westwood, claiming Bassett's first Pac-8 championship in 1969 and laying the foundation for NCAA titles in 1970 and 1971.

Barth went on to compete in the singles and doubles draws of each Grand Slam tournament, notching a career-best fourth-round singles showing at the 1969 US Open. He is now the Director Emeritus of Tennis at the Kiaweh Island Golf Resort southwest of Charleston, S.C., where he has spent over 40 years.

Barth joins fellow Bruins Marcel Freeman (inducted in 2011), Brad Pearce (2009), Jim Pugh (2008), Jeff Borowiak (2006), Ferdi Taygan (2006), Larry Nagler (2004), Brian Teacher (2001), Peter Fleming (1998), Ian Crookenden (1997), Bob Perry (1997), Billy Martin (1996), Bassett (1993), Frank Stewart (1992), Jack Tidball (1992), Allen Fox (1988), Herb Flam (1987), Charles Pasarell (1987), Jimmy Connors (1986), Bill Ackerman (1984), Arthur Ashe (1983) and J.D. Morgan (1983) in the ITA Men's Collegiate Tennis Hall of Fame.
